Output 9657664bdfdeb15c125f38f22eea68b1420c808ac65d468d2d2df3a714fe9959:1

value
192842206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f38e0ff21ed192bae90ad70ef61f27974015c3 OP_EQUAL
address
39Lumxa8uHa9468NPhDkTfEdCnakHfdZ7z
transaction
9657664bdfdeb15c125f38f22eea68b1420c808ac65d468d2d2df3a714fe9959
spent
true